Do you dream of being a
radio dj or personality and playing your favorite songs for a career?
What Does a Radio DJ Really Do Anyway? Radio personalities for the most part, talk in between songs and provide information, and entertainment. Some radio DJs are notorious for their personalities. If you're looking to play all of your favorite music however, that's probably not going to happen. Usually a radio station's program director or music directors generate the playlist. Only a very small percentage of nationally recognized radio talents make the "big bucks." The positions that usually pay the most are morning show hosts and program directors. They have the top wages associated with this type of entertainment industry. |

Be Visible and Audible Introduce yourself to the dance music industry. Nobody has succeeded by concealing their gifts and you'll certainly not be the first to break the mould. In anything that you do, make sure that this is seen, heard, acknowledged and praised. Be a member of online societies catering to dance music aficionados. Nowadays, you should tap the power of social connections to your benefit including getting to know other DJs and clubbers, especially industry honchos looking for fresh talent. Utilize the web and all its freebies. As YouTube and dropyourtalent.com are becoming more recognized, you may upload your work there and ask your fans to spread the word. Of course, be responsible for the excellence and quantity of your music videos. All the great DJs - Tiesto, Paul van Dyke, Armin Van Buuren, Fatboy Slim, to name a few - have to find their unique sound and so should you. In this kind of industry, you should find your own beat, literally and fiquratively. Towards this goal, you have to practice, practice, practice and produce, produce, produce. You should never grow tired of turning that turntable, listening to the beat and mixing your music. When the day is through, you have to do all of these again tomorrow; there's just no turning back. |
